Additional charges following Pateley Bridge hit-and-run collision

21 January 2026

A man has been charged with two further offences as the investigation into the fatal hit-and-run collision in Pateley Bridge continues.

In December, officers charged a 25-year-old man with:

  • Driving a motor vehicle when over the prescribed limit
  • Using a motor vehicle on a road public/place without insurance

The same man has now also been charged with failing to stop after a road traffic collision and failing to report a road traffic collision.

He is due to appear at court on the 12 February 2026.

The man also remains under investigation for the offence of causing death by dangerous driving.

Officers continue to appeal for any information about the fatal collision which sadly claimed the life of 19-year-old Bailey Chadwick.

The incident happened in the early hours of Sunday 20 July 2025 on the B6265 at Lupton Bank between Glasshouses and Pateley Bridge.
